About API
About API
Blog Article
APIs are mechanisms that allow two program factors to talk to one another using a set of definitions and protocols.
ICP tests, designed in partnership with industry leaders, confirms that certified inspectors and personnel will reveal competence in content material spots that happen to be related for their procedures.
Execute assessments as normally as needed without having restrictions, making certain complete validation and trustworthiness of APIS.
Should the API grants use of useful electronic assets, a company monetizes it by offering access. This observe is generally known as the API economic climate.
Parameters: Parameters are definitely the variables which might be handed to an API endpoint to deliver certain Directions for that API to system. These parameters may be included in the API ask for as Component of the URL, during the query string, or from the ask for physique.
The API client is chargeable for setting up the conversation by sending the ask for to the API server. The ask for might be triggered in some ways.
There are plenty of benefits of this system that we can easily understand and browse on the internet. There
Nevertheless, the ability to aid numerous formats for storing and exchanging facts is amongst the good reasons Relaxation is really a prevailing choice for making general public APIs.
Relaxation APIs follows a set construction, and often return an entire knowledge set for any specified item. If the request is a lot more sophisticated, spanning many sources, as an example, the customer have to post separate requests for every source. These restrictions may lead to underneath or more than-fetching API Design easy difficulties.
This eradicates the necessity for the API shopper to poll the server, since the server will automatically conduct the right motion or return the applicable details when the specified occasion takes place.
GraphQL APIs empower more flexible, productive facts fetching, which may increase procedure functionality and simplicity-of-use for builders. These characteristics make GraphQL In particular handy for making APIs in advanced environments with speedily altering front-finish demands.4
Although You can not see them, APIs are just about everywhere—Functioning constantly from the background to power the digital experiences which have been necessary to our modern lives.
Discover how an optimized Java runtime maximizes your cloud compute and see simply how much it lowers your fees.
For example, the Instagram API allows companies to embed their Instagram grid on their own Site and for the grid to update mechanically as consumers increase new posts.